  • Established in 1987 as a non-profit 501c3, Southern Caregiver Resource Center (SCRC) is the leading provider of free caregiver support services for families caring for frail older adults and adults living with Alzheimer’s disease and related disorders in San Diego County. Serving over 80,000 families annually, SCRC offers a wide variety of support services that include education, care planning, case management, counseling, respite care and support groups.     In this month's episode, Roberto and Martha chat with Frank, a CFO for Coast Care, Cal Aim Department. Listen to their discussion about the benefits of respite services for caregivers. Although rewarding, caregiving comes with its own set of demands. Very often, family caregivers can find themselves managing their loved one's complex medical and cognitive issues over the course of months or years. Frank shares how he and his wife provided 30 years of around the clock care for his mother in law after a stroke left her fully disabled.

    Listen to Frank's personal narrative as he candidly discusses the physical and emotional impacts of caregiving, and the need for caregivers to seek out respite care from time to time.
